Colonel Richard O'Connell (born 1902), always referred to as O'Connell or Rick, is the main protagonist of Stephen Sommers' The Mummy trilogy.
He was portrayed by Brendan Fraser, who also portrayed Link in Encino Man, Trever Anderson in Journey to the Center of the Earth, George in George of the Jungle, Stu Miley in Monkeybone, D.J. Drake in Looney Tunes: Back in Action, Robot Man in Doom Patrol, and Charlie in The Whale. John Schneider voiced Rick in the cartoon. Toshiyuki Morikawa voiced Rick in the film trilogy's Japanese dub.
Personality[]
Rick O'Connell was, if anything, a man of action that believed in shooting first and asking questions later, being curt and brash when he needed to be. Although O'Connell acted with bravado in most situations, he was not incapable of pathos and sympathy, having fallen in love with and marrying Evelyn Carnahan, and fathering a son with her, considering his family to be the most important thing in his life. Along with his prowess in firearms, O'Connell was also proficient at defending himself unarmed and knew how to improvise when in a perilous situation.
Tall, with brown parted hair and blue-green eyes, O'Connell was usually seen wearing a white long-sleeved shirt, tan chinos, brown boots, a belt, and holsters when he was on expeditions; this outfit was accompanied sometimes by a blue kerchief as well as any number of firearms and blades. Years later, Rick would sometimes wear a blue shirt, designated as his favorite, in place of the white one, still wearing his holsters, with shoes in place of his boots. Rick usually wore a leather wristband on his right wrist to conceal the tattoo that was given to him in a Cairo orphanage years ago; this tattoo designating him a Medjai. Rick's preferred knife in combat was a butterfly knife. When at home in London years after his exploits, Rick wore clothing typical of an English civilian: a necktie and vest, changing into a suit and tie for more serious events, accompanied by a fedora and trench coat when out of his home. Formal events saw Rick wear a tuxedo, but taking great care to keep his holsters under the jacket, equipped with guns, should trouble arise.
As a combatant, O'Connell almost always prefers to utilize firearms, making it a point to carry a large satchel containing all types of weapons and ammo. As a gunman, he is highly proficient with almost any type of firearm, particularly his signature revolvers as well as shotguns and rifles. Similarly, his accuracy is quite impressive, able to hit both moving and long-distance targets with relative ease. Additionally, he is a capable brawler when hand-to-hand is required, and a surprisingly capable swordsman.
As a soldier and officer in the French Foreign Legion, Rick was required to learn and speak French.

Trivia[]
- Rick seems to be heavily inspired by Indiana Jones (a tough American adventurer from the early 20th century) and Lara Croft (a pistol-wielding adventurer), though Rick is less educated and more brutish than the two.
